The volume of the triangular pyramid below is 12.5 cm. What is the height of the pyramid? 6 cm 5 cm​

Answer:

A. 2.5 cm

Explanation:

h = 3×V / A

= 3× 12.5 /(½×5×6)

= 37.5 / 15

= 2.5 cm
